OverviewProfessor Gromada has provided fellow-theologians and researchers with a complete and accurate history of the different stages, transitions and influences which lead to the actual text on ministry in 'Baptism, Eucharist, and Ministry' (BEM) produced by the Faith and Order Commission of the World Council of Churches in January 1982 in Lima, Peru. In this serious and methodical exposition, both published and unpublished sources and documentation are utilized as well as the author-participant's own material. In addition, individual theologians and theological perspectives are identified and highlghted and the eventual direction of ecumenical discussions is fully described.
